What clinical diagnostic standards are applied when assessing patients for OCD?
Clinicians perform comprehensive psychiatric evaluations using validated assessment scales, such as the Yale-Brown Obsessive Compulsive Scale (Y-BOCS), to evaluate the severity of intrusive thoughts, repetitive behaviors, and functional impairment.

When should individuals seek professional OCD care?
Professional care should be initiated when unwanted, intrusive thoughts (obsessions) or the urge to perform repetitive behaviors (compulsions) begin to consume significant time and interfere with daily routines, work, or relationships.
